I wasn't very hungry this evening so I just had a tin of potato and leek soup and some bread. I was 4.9 mmol/l before and bolused my usual amount for the food about 20 mins before eating. Thought I would test at an hour and a half after eating to see what level I was at, and it was 3.2! Had some jelly babies and tested half an hour later - 3.1! More jelly babies and tested an hour after - 3.4! Blimey! Yet more JBs. Now had some toast and half an hour after I'm 5.4.

I must have picked up the extra potent insulin by mistake! 😱

I think the carbs in soup probably get digested very much quicker as they're in liquid form. They may well 'hit' before the insulin gets to work
 
I think the carbs in soup probably get digested very much quicker as they're in liquid form. They may well 'hit' before the insulin gets to work

I had injected quite a bit before eating though, and this doesn't normally happen to me with soup. I think what may have happened is that I still had some active insulin from my lunch bolus as it was less than 5 hours previously. Seriously, soup seems to be a hard one to get right for Alex too. I normally make my own soup and carb count - but it used to send him hypo within half an hour or so - so now I just do a 'guess' of about 8 or 10 carbs - not based on anything at all - and this seems to have solved the problem - I think because it is a liquid as has been mentioned it must have a different profile than a 'normal' carb perhaps....🙂Bev
